1

Organizing Your Next Trip in the UK?

carlycbfo195201
Alwaz Travels is your preferred travel company in the UK. We offer a extensive range of travel packages to suit all your needs. Whether you're searching for a relaxing beach getaway, a action-packed city trip, or a https://nexpro.travedeus.com
Report this page

Comments

    HTML is allowed

Who Upvoted this Story